What are Isolation Chambers?

Isolation chambers are enclosed tanks filled with warm, buoyant water saturated with Epsom salt. This unique environment allows users to float effortlessly, reducing the effects of gravity on the body. As the chamber is soundproof and dark, it minimizes distractions, promoting relaxation and introspection.

Benefits of Using an Isolation Chamber

The benefits of using isolation chambers extend beyond relaxation. Users often report reduced anxiety, improved sleep quality, enhanced creativity, and relief from chronic pain. The sensory deprivation experience can also facilitate meditation and self-discovery.

FAQ

What is an isolation chamber?
An isolation chamber, or float tank, is a dark, soundproof tank filled with warm, salty water designed to eliminate external stimuli, allowing for deep relaxation and meditation.

How much do isolation chambers cost?
Prices for isolation chambers can range from about $1,940 for basic home models to over $50,000 for professional commercial tanks.

What are the benefits of floating?
Floating can reduce stress, anxiety, and chronic pain, improve sleep quality, enhance creativity, and facilitate meditation.

How often should I use an isolation chamber?
Frequency varies by individual preference, but many users benefit from regular sessions, ranging from weekly to monthly.

Are commercial float tanks different from home tanks?
Yes, commercial float tanks are built for frequent use with advanced filtration systems and larger capacities compared to home tanks.

What should I wear in a float tank?
Swimwear is typically recommended, but many users choose to float nude for a more sensory-free experience.

How long do I stay in an isolation chamber?
Sessions usually last between 60 to 90 minutes, allowing ample time to relax and benefit from the experience.

Can I listen to music while floating?
Some float tanks are equipped with sound systems, allowing users to listen to calming music or guided meditations.

Is there an age limit for using float tanks?
While there is no strict age limit, minors should have parental consent, and those with specific medical conditions should consult a healthcare provider before use.
